O.J. SIMPSON’s lawyers are preparing another appeal to overturn his kidnap and armed robbery convictions after a Nevada judge ruled against him on Friday (22Oct10).
The former American footballer-turned-actor is serving a minimum of nine years in prison after he was found guilty of masterminding a heist on two sports memorabilia dealers’ hotel room in September 2007, to retrieve family photos and mementos. He was convicted in December (08).
The retired sportsman lodged an appeal in May 2009, claiming judicial misconduct, a lack of racial diversity on the jury and errors in sentencing and jury instructions.
On Friday, a judge concluded each of Simpson’s eight appeal arguments were without merit.
The 63-year-old’s attorney Yale Galanter characterised Simpson’s conviction as "payback" for the star’s double-murder acquittal involving the 1994 slayings of his ex-wife, Nicole Brown Simpson, and her friend Ron Goldman. Galanter plans to file a new appeal.
He tells the Associated Press, "This is but the first step in a very long line of appeals that Mr. Simpson has before him." In a separate ruling, the court ordered the conviction of Simpson’s co-defendant Clarence ‘C.J.’ Stewart to be reversed and a new trial held. Stewart, who was also convicted of kidnapping, armed robbery and conspiracy, is serving seven-and-a-half to 27 years.
Four other men took plea deals and received probation.

BROADWAY STARS JONES, HILL AMONG FIRST BARNES AWARD FINALISTS

Posted in: Entertainment — PR-inside Entertainment News @ 8:23 pm

Broadway stars KENDRICK JONES and JON MICHAEL HILL are among nominees for the inaugural Clive Barnes Awards, in honour of the celebrated theatre and dance critic.
The Scottsboro Boys star Jones and Hill of Superior Donuts have been nominated alongside fellow acting newcomers Nina Arianda of Venus in Fur and Noah Robbins of Secrets of the Trade for the prizegiving.
The event honours one winner in the two categories of acting and dance, and the finalists for the latter include Aaron Carr (Keigwin + Company), Hee Seo (American Ballet Theatre) and Leann Underwood (American Ballet Theatre), reports Variety.
The non-profit Clive Barnes Foundation established the ceremony following the death of the famed theatre and dance critic, who died in 2008 at the age of 81.
Barnes’ work appeared in the New York Times, the New York Post and many other publications.
His widow, Valerie Taylor Barnes, gathered a "strong-minded panel" to pick finalists for the awards ceremony, which will be held on 9 November (10) at Lincoln Center’s Walter Reade Theater.
